World leaders send their condolences

China Daily | Updated: 2008-05-13 07:56

World leaders yesterday sent their condolences to the victims of the massive earthquake in China, in which more than 8,500 are feared dead.

United Nations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on expressed his deep sympathy during a telephone conversation with Foreign Minister Yang Jiechi.

Ban said that, upon learning that Sichuan province was hit by the quake, he, on behalf of the UN, expressed deep sympathy and sincere solicitude toward the Chinese government and people, and deep condolences over those killed.
